Konami follows up on its popular NES conversion of EA skating sim Skate or Die with a game that has almost nothing to do with the source material aside from the use of skateboards. While not an entirely successful game, thanks largely to its memorization-heavy design, it is at least one of the more interesting original projects we've seen for the platform so far.

The water is one of those things that doesn't translate to Super Game Boy very well. The flashing effect creates an illusion of transparency on the GB's slow screen, but on a proper monitor with a 60fps refresh rate it's hideous.
